Hope is a gaunt, 60-year old man, a little deaf, and although he can get riled up easily, he is immensely likable. He runs the No-Chance Saloon, a place he hasn't left for 20 years, since his wife Bessie's death. Before her death, he was going to be an Alderman but that dream was derailed. Act II features the long-awaited Hickey, the sad spectacle of Harry Hope ’s birthday party, and clear indications that Hickey’s presence is disrupting the dynamics of the group. In regards to that last point, while the men and women always teased each other, now the teasing has a darker, more judgmental air. ウイ 身长
